Question: The solution curve of \(\frac{dy}{dx}\)= \(\frac{y^{2} - 2xy - x^{2}}{y^{2} + 2xy - x^{2}}\), y(–1) ...
The solution curve of dxdy= y2+2xy−x2y2−2xy−x2, y(–1) = 1 is-
A
A parabola
B
Ellipse
C
Circle
D
Straight line
Answer
Straight line
Explanation
Solution
Solving the homogeneous equation, by using
y = vx, we find the solution x + y = c(x2 + y2) y(–1) = 1 Ž x + y = 0 which is a straight line.
